About

Marion E. Simpson is a scholar working on Plant Science, Agronomy and Crop Science and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Marion E. Simpson has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 430 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Plant Science, 2 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science and 2 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. Recurrent topics in Marion E. Simpson’s work include Research in Cotton Cultivation (7 papers), Mycotoxins in Agriculture and Food (5 papers) and Biofuel production and bioconversion (2 papers). Marion E. Simpson is often cited by papers focused on Research in Cotton Cultivation (7 papers), Mycotoxins in Agriculture and Food (5 papers) and Biofuel production and bioconversion (2 papers). Marion E. Simpson coll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and United Kingdom. Marion E. Simpson's co-authors include Paul B. Marsh, D. A. Dinius, Mary W Trucksess, George V. Merola, Renato Ferretti, T. Colin Campbell, G. D. Paulson, J. E. Bakke, Jeffrey M. Giddings and H. H. Ramey and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ry and Journal of Environmental Quality.
